1080 Beacon St. is located in Brookline, at the junction of Harvard Street and Commonwealth Avenue. This spot offers a blend of urban life and community energy. The nearby Charles River adds to the landscape, providing scenic local views. Access to highways and public transportation eases travel to other areas. The building stands as a low-rise structure with 1 story and contains 40 condominium units. Built in 1915, it features one- to four-bedroom units ranging in size from 734 to 2,664 square feet. Prices begin at $585,000, offering various options for buyers. Residents enjoy a variety of amenities that enhance daily living. There is laundry service and hot water in the building. Coolidge Corner is a lively shopping and transportation hub in Norfolk County. The area has numerous small boutiques, cafes, and restaurants along the main streets. It has a historic theater, a public library, and small green parks. You can find grocery stores, banks, health clinics, and pharmacies nearby. The district hosts seasonal markets and local events. The area sits on several bus routes and the light rail line, and transportation links make travel to nearby cities easy. Bike lanes and walkable streets help short trips. The district offers quick access to main roads for drivers.
